Institution Overview
Belmont University is a private, non-profit institution in Nashville with 7,306 students. The university has a high acceptance rate of 96.4% and a retention rate of 83.7%. The graduation rate is 72.1%. The annual in-state tuition is $41,320, and 34.8% of students receive financial aid.
Graduates of Belmont University report earnings of $37,296 one year after graduation, $42,770 after five years, and $55,930 after ten years. The median student debt is $20,500.
